Corkman caught with cannabis worth €300,000 to be sentenced next year
The main seizure of cannabis — with a street value of €300,000 — at the man's home, saw him charged with possessing cannabis herb and possessing cannabis herb for sale of supply.
Sentencing of a man caught with a €300,000 stash of cannabis at a house in Sunday’s Well will be sentenced on February 2, 2024.
That was the date set by Judge Helen Boyle at Cork Circuit Criminal Court when the 33-year-old Cork man affirmed his plea of guilty to the charges against him.
